Tendency

During Thursday night the weather will change with onset of precipitations and wind. Until then, the avalanche situation will not change significantly.

Avalanche Activity

Not much snow at intermediate altitudes in the Bavarian Alps.

In the morning avalanche danger is low, but later rises to moderate in line with the daytime danger cycle. Main problem: wet snow. Naturally releasing, predominantly small, superficial wet snow avalanches can be expected in steep terrain due to solar radiation and rise in temperature during the course of the day. Isolated small glide snow avalanches can trigger at ground level on steep smooth grass-covered slopes. Glide cracks indicate danger. In addition, isolated weak intermediate layers are found in the old snowpack in extremely steep north to east-facing terrain. There, avalanches can still be triggered by large additional loading and can grow to medium size.

Snowpack Structure

At intermediate altitude the snowpack is mostly encrusted in the morning, has settled well and is stable. As a consequence of solar radiation and mild temperatures the snowpack surface moistens thoroughly during the course of the day and as a result the snowpack forfeits its firmness. In a few spots in extremely steep shady terrain weak intermediate layers have persisted in the old snowpack that consist of expansively metamorphosed (faceted) crystals and are prone to triggering. On sunny slopes the ground has become bare again up to high altitudes in many places.
